BZA Approved Signs For WMS
Among the agenda items considered by the hearing officer for the Kosciusko County Board of Zoning Appeals Monday in Warsaw was a petition by the Wawasee Community School Corp. The school corporation wants to update signs at Wawasee Middle School on SR 13 at the intersection with CR 1000 North, south of Syracuse.
One sign on the west side of the building above the main entrance will have the letters “Wawasee Middle School,” while the other sign will replace an existing sign along SR 13. The new sign will be an LED version. Both signs were approved by the hearing officer. Approval was required because the total square footage of signage exceeds the 32 square-feet normally allowed by ordinance.
Petitions considered by the BZA Tuesday included:
- Approval was given to Mark and Shelia Tenner for construction of a pole barn 10 feet away from an access easement on CR 300 North, east of CR 150 East in Plain Township.
- James and Julie Maxwell were given approval to allow a duplex to remain on a tract of land less than 30,000 square-feet on Kalorama Road in Tippecanoe Township.
- Aaron Bakian was granted a variance to allow a mobile home to remain as placed, but must remove a shed out of the right of way and pay a permit fee. The property is on Old Road 30, east of Walnut Street in Etna Green.
- Cary Groninger was granted an exception to build an oversized accessory building for storage of maintenance equipment on Leigh Drive, west of Fox Farm Road in Wayne Township.
- Michelle and Matthew Kerlin were granted a variance to build a residence addition on EMS W31 Lane, west of CR 825 East in Tippecanoe Township.
- Tammi Mazura was granted an exception for a home-based business, in this case consignment sales/auctions, in an existing barn on CR 800 South, east of CR 700 East in Monroe Township.
